About Outlook Care:

Outlook Care is a specialist provider of learning disability services across London and Essex. We also specialise in dementia elderly care end of life and mental health. Outlook Care started in 1990 and has now been running for over 30 years. We pride ourselves on our strong values:

Job Role:

You should be able todemonstrate an understanding of the home environment for our residents and engage with residents sensitively and with dignity. The role includes carrying out routine scheduled cleaning and general housekeeping and laundry tasks to ensure a high standard of cleanliness within the home.Experience is an advantage though full training will be provided to applicants with transferable skills.

The Service:

St Georges Nursing Home in Witham provides residential and nursing care and specialises in high dependency intermediate and longterm palliative care and end of life care. Our philosophy is to provide our residents with a relaxed and comfortable home in which their nursing care needs wellbeing and choice are of prime importance. We achieve this by putting our residents at the centre of all decisions about their lives and by encouraging them to exercise their rights in all aspects of their care. We strive to preserve and maintain the dignity individuality and privacy of all residents within a warm and caring environment that is both safe and comfortable.
